摘要: 题目 给定间隔的集合,合并所有重叠间隔。 例如, 给定[1,3],[2,6],[8,10],[15,18] return [1,6],[8,10],[15,18]。 题目分析:合并重叠的数组,这里首先是定义排序规则,给所有数组进行排序,然后合并重叠的就行了。 代码 /** * Definition 阅读全文
posted @ 2017-02-05 11:52 Kobe10 阅读(689) 评论(0) 推荐(0) 编辑
摘要: 题目: 有N个孩子站在一排。 每个孩子被分配一个评分值。 你给这些孩子的糖果满足以下要求: 每个孩子必须有至少一个糖果。 评分较高的孩子比他们的邻居获得更多的糖果。 你必须给的最低糖果是什么? 题目分析:这个题目其实就是简单的遍历问题。一个打乱的数组,每个数字都有一个特定的属性值,相邻两个数字大的数 阅读全文
posted @ 2017-02-05 10:14 Kobe10 阅读(1335) 评论(0) 推荐(0) 编辑